<FILE>gtkcssprovider</FILE>
<TITLE>GtkCssProvider</TITLE>
GtkCssProvider
-gtk_css_provider_get_default
gtk_css_provider_get_named
gtk_css_provider_load_from_data
gtk_css_provider_load_from_file
g_object_unref (file);
}
-/**
- * gtk_css_provider_get_default:
- *
- * Returns the provider containing the style settings used as a
- * fallback for all widgets.
- *
- * Returns: (transfer none): The provider used for fallback styling.
- * This memory is owned by GTK+, and you must not free it.
- **/
-GtkCssProvider *
-gtk_css_provider_get_default (void)
-{
- static GtkCssProvider *provider;
-
- if (G_UNLIKELY (!provider))
- {
- provider = gtk_css_provider_new ();
- }
-
- return provider;
-}
-
gchar *
_gtk_get_theme_dir (void)
{
void gtk_css_provider_load_from_resource (GtkCssProvider *css_provider,
const gchar *resource_path);
-GDK_AVAILABLE_IN_ALL
-GtkCssProvider * gtk_css_provider_get_default (void);
-
GDK_AVAILABLE_IN_ALL
GtkCssProvider * gtk_css_provider_get_named (const gchar *name,
const gchar *variant);